The Evolution of the UK Powertool Market
Over the previous decade, the UK powertool industry has gone through a huge change. The most considerable shift has actually been the fast development of lithium-ion battery technology. Where corded tools when dominated building sites due to power constraints, modern cordless powertools now match-- and sometimes surpass-- the performance of their wired predecessors.
Furthermore, ergonomic styles, brushless motors, and smart-battery management systems have enhanced efficiency and user comfort. Today, tradespeople can complete a whole workday on a single battery platform across several devices, reducing downtime and removing the threat of tracking cables on busy job websites.

When buyingpowertools in the UK, among the very first decisions & to make is whether to go corded or cordless. Both choices have unique advantages depending upon the application. Cordless Powertools Pros: Ultimate mobility, no tripping hazards, safer for workingat heights, fast technological developments. Cons: Batteries include weight, in advance expenses can be high if acquiring multiple bare tools and batteries, and batteries ultimately deteriorate over time. Best for: General building and construction, carpentry, setup work, and remote places without trusted power gain access to

How should I keep my powertools during UK winter seasons? Extreme cold and wet conditions can destroy lithium-ion batteries and cause metal parts to rust. Store your powertools in a dry, temperature-controlled environment, and remove batteries from
the tools if they are going to sit unused for prolonged periods. The UK powertool
